I am developing a Rich Client talking to my jboss server via Session Beans. Now
within my Session Bean, I have the following Function:
| public List<Domaindata> getAllDomains(String orderByColumn)
| {
| Query query = em.createQuery("select d from Domaindata AS d ORDER
BY :column");
| query.setParameter("column", orderByColumn);
|
| return query.getResultList();
| }
|
on the client side i am calling this function through its remote interface
| DomainRobotRemote robot =
CommunicationHandler.getInstance().getDomainRobot();
| List<Domaindata> domains = robot.getAllDomains("name");
| for (Domaindata d : domains)
| {
| theNode.add(new DefaultMutableTreeNode(d.getName()));
| }
|
I can see the query translated by hibernate as
| 16:08:06,302 INFO [STDOUT] Hibernate: select ... borc.DOMAINDATA
domaindata0_ order by ?
|
but the result list is not ordered.
If I explicitly order by a specific domain as in
| public List<Domaindata> getAllDomainsByName()
| {
| return em.createQuery("from Domaindata domain order by
domain.name").getResultList();
| }
|
Everything is working fine. Isn't it possible to dynamically say what Column I
want the Result list to be orderd by?
